suspension

I went to goodyear the other day lookin for new tires and a guy there told me that rangers tend to lean toward the driver side. Now that he said i notice that 96 splash ranger does exactly that. Is there any way to fix this?

Ranger Suspension

I also had the sagging rearend on my 1998 Ranger. I installed a set of Bilstein gas shocks and they cured the problem. The truck handles fantastic and sits about 1" higher than before. The suspension is tight and corners like its on rails. The Bilsteins are the best money you can spend.
